The Indian Nursing Council has taken giant strides and revised the syllabus for all nursing programmes. As well, it is observed that there is dearth of Indian textbooks for student’s reference based on new syllabus. The foreign textbooks do not adequately represent Indian cultural and demographic scenarios. Hence, it was felt a dire need for Nurse Educators and the council to write the nursing textbooks for students hailing from Indian background.
Therefore the council has taken the initiative to provide a forum for the faculty to author the textbooks. This Council intends to promote 47 nursing titles with the help of qualified and rich experienced faculties from Tamilnadu.
In this connection, on 22nd September 2009 an “Authors Meet” was conducted with the faculty members who had given their consent to author the text books. During the “Authors Meet”, a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) was signed between Dr. G. Josephine, Registrar of Tamilnadu Nurses and Midwives Council and Ms. Renu Kaul, Managing Director of M/s. Vitmed Publishing to promote nursing textbooks and in turn the authors signed an MOU with the council on the text book units and chapters to be written by concerned individual faculty authors.
So far 150 Nursing Faculties have signed the MOU with the Council to Author Nursing Textbooks and strengthened the initiative. The following deliberations were also done to guide the authors. Subsequently, handouts of all the presentations were given.

Followed by the presentations group discussions were held between the convenors and member authors of various nursing text books and the units and chapters to be written by individual authors were selected personally by them. The meeting ended with great sense of commitment and togetherness among the proposed authors.
